From e6f6731ad82fc4b7dda4267840df074f992f7442 Mon Sep 17 00:00:00 2001 From: Saturneric Date: Mon, 7 Feb 2022 19:55:13 +0800 Subject: (core, ui): Fix the remaining problems in the data object --- src/core/function/DataObjectOperator.cpp |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'src/core/function/DataObjectOperator.cpp') diff --git a/src/core/function/DataObjectOperator.cpp b/src/core/function/DataObjectOperator.cpp index f1395152..1c7bd31a 100644 --- a/src/core/function/DataObjectOperator.cpp +++ b/src/core/function/DataObjectOperator.cpp @@ -62,6 +62,9 @@ GpgFrontend::DataObjectOperator::DataObjectOperator(int channel) std::string GpgFrontend::DataObjectOperator::SaveDataObj( const std::string& _key, const nlohmann::json& value) { + + LOG(INFO) << _("Save data object") << _key; + std::string _hash_obj_key = {}; if (_key.empty()) { _hash_obj_key = @@ -121,8 +124,11 @@ std::optional GpgFrontend::DataObjectOperator::GetDataObject( auto decoded = encryption.removePadding(encryption.decode(encoded, hash_key_)); + LOG(INFO) << _("Load data object") << _key; + return nlohmann::json::parse(decoded.toStdString()); } catch (...) { + LOG(ERROR) << _("Failed to get data object") << _key; return {}; } } -- cgit v1.2.3